GLEIF Signs eMudhra as Validator for Indian LEI Issuer

EMudhra, a global provider of digital identity, authentication, and trust services, has been appointed as a Validation Agent of Legal Entity Identifier India Limited (LEIL) in the Global Legal Entity Identifier System by the Global Legal Entity Identifier Foundation (GLEIF).

The partnership will enable eMudhra to embed Legal Entity Identifier (LEI) application and renewal services directly into established customer onboarding and identity verification processes.

Legal Entity Identifier India is the only issuer recognised by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) under the Payment and Settlement Systems Act.

Kaushik Srinivasan, co-founder of eMudhra, said: “Becoming a Validation Agent of LEIL in the Global LEI System is a natural extension of eMudhra’s role as a trusted Certifying Authority.”

The integration will enable organisations across India to fulfil regulatory identity requirements while reducing the need to complete separate verification checks. India became the jurisdiction with the highest number of active LEIs in January following a master direction iss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I).
